Overview

Nebius AI is hiring a Senior Technical Program Manager to lead the delivery of GPU clusters and critical IT infrastructure for AI workloads. You'll coordinate across teams and manage risk to ensure successful launches. This role requires experience in cloud infrastructure and project management.

What you'll do

As a Senior Technical Program Manager at Nebius AI, you will lead the end-to-end delivery of new data center programs, from design through handover to operations. You will define project scopes, develop detailed project plans, and ensure that all teams are aligned on objectives and timelines. Your role will involve regular communication with stakeholders to provide updates on progress and address any concerns that may arise.

You will work closely with infrastructure leadership to define strategies for scaling operations across the US markets — your insights will help shape the direction of our infrastructure initiatives and ensure that we are well-positioned to meet the demands of our customers. You will also be responsible for managing risks associated with project delivery, proactively identifying potential roadblocks and developing contingency plans to mitigate them.

During key deployment phases, you may be required to be on-site at data centers to oversee critical activities and ensure that everything runs smoothly — your presence will be vital in coordinating efforts and addressing any issues that arise in real-time.
